Article delegate-en/2896 of [1-5169] on the server localhost:119
  upper oldest olders older1 this newer1 newers latest
search
[Top/Up] [oldest] - [Older+chunk] - [Newer+chunk] - [newest + Check]

Newsgroups: mail-lists.delegate-en

[DeleGate-En] Re: Compilation of delegate 8.11.2
06 Apr 2005 12:50:19 GMT "Rousseau Pierre \(DBB\)" <pjyfqbdyi-gztnjky4fbnr.ml@ml.delegate.org>



Hello,

Thanks for the help.
I have tried your advices...but without success. I substitute CC with GCC (cc is a link to gcc binary). Parameter "-x c++" seems to be ok. TELEPORT library still have something wrong. After "make clean", I execute "make CFLAGSPLUS="-DNONC99 -DQS -TP"". I still have problem. If I execute a second time the last compile command (cc _.o -L../lib ../lib/libresolvy.a   ../lib/libteleport.a ../lib/libmd5.a ../lib/libcfi.a ../lib/library.a ../lib/libmimekit.a  ../lib/libfsx.a -lnsl -lpam -lstdc++ ../lib/library.a -lc), problem is still the same.
Maybe you have idea(s) about this issue?
Is it normal that "mkcpp" is not include in the pakage?

Have a nice day,
Pierre



 LDLIBS=../lib/libresolvy.a   ../lib/libteleport.a ../lib/libmd5.a ../lib/libcfi.a ../lib/library.a ../lib/libmimekit.a  ../lib/libfsx.a -lnsl -lpam -lstdc++ ../lib/library.a -lc
        Files=dummy.c  gxx.c  __uname.c uname.c  bcopy.c  putenv.c  __alloca.c old_alloca.c alloca.c  killpg.c  setsid.c  sigmask.c  sigsetmask.c  setresuid.c  seteuid.c  setegid.c  timegm.c  __usleep.c usleep.c  _-poll.c _-select.c  _-recv.c  closesocket.c  yp_match.c  endhostent.c  socklen_u.c socklen_s.c  socketpair.c  inet_aton.c  strerror.c  strcasecmp.c  strcasestr.c  strstr.c  strdup.c  strncpy.c  snprintf.c  setbuffer.c  setlinebuf.c  __syslog.c syslog.c  __syscall.c  __fork.c fork.c  __ptrace.c _-ptrace.c ptrace.c  __sigaction.c sigaction.c  __utimes.c utimes.c fsync.c  __fchmod.c fchmod.c  __fchown.c fchown.c  chown.c  __link.c link.c  __symlink.c symlink.c  readlink.c  __lstat.c lstat.c  __statvfs.c _-statvfs.c statvfs.c  vfork.c  wait3.c  waitpid.c  getmsg.c  chroot.c  nice.c  __getrlimit.c getrlimit.c  ___spawnvp.c __spawnvp.c _spawnvp.c spawnvp.c spawnvp_.c  ___lwp_create.c __lwp_create.c __pthread_create.c  _-CreateThread.c ___beginthread.c nothread.c  __locking.c  __flock.c _-fcntl.c  FMODE.c  getwd.c  getcwd.c  __opendir.c __scandir.c ___findfirst.c  pam_start.c  stdio.c  errno.c
         -- checking CC = cc
         -- checking CC with CFLAGS = cc -c -O -x c++ -DQS
         -- checking LDLIBS = ../lib/libresolvy.a   ../lib/libteleport.a ../lib/libmd5.a ../lib/libcfi.a ../lib/library.a ../lib/libmimekit.a  ../lib/libfsx.a -lnsl -lpam -lstdc++ ../lib/library.a -lc
##ERROR## ***
##ERROR## cc _.o -L../lib ../lib/libresolvy.a   ../lib/libteleport.a ../lib/libmd5.a ../lib/libcfi.a ../lib/library.a ../lib/libmimekit.a  ../lib/libfsx.a -lnsl -lpam -lstdc++ ../lib/library.a -lc
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.bcopy(void const*, void*, unsigned long)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.strcasestr(char const*, char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.Xgetpeername(int, sockaddr*,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.Xaccept(int, sockaddr*,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.setBinaryIO()
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.Xgetsockname(int, sockaddr*,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.Xrecvfrom(int, void*, unsigned long, int, sockaddr*,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.PollIns(int, int, int*,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.CTX_auth(DGCtx*, char const*, char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.GetViaSocks(DGCtx*, char const*,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.bindViaSocks(DGCtx*, char const*, int, char const*, int, char const*, int, char const*,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.acceptViaSocks(int, char const*, int, char const*, int, char const*,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.PollOut(int,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.Usleep(int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.connRESETbypeer()
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.connHUP()
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.PollIn1(int,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.Uname(char const*, int, char const*, int, char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.Xgetsockopt(int, int, int, void*,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.getpeersNAME(int, char const*, int, char const*, int, char const*, char const*, int, char const*, int, char const*,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.sendTimeout(int, char const*, int, int,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.sv1log(char const*, ...)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.sendTo(int, char const*, char const*,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.sv1vlog(char const*, ...)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.readfrom(int, void*, int, char const*, int, char const*, int, char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.getpeerName(int, char const*, int, char const*, int, char const*, char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.HostId(char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.sockHostport(int,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.server_open(char const*, char const*, int, char const*, int, char const*, int,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.ACCEPT(int, int, int,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.Socketpair(int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: SPAWN_P_NOWAIT
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.spawnvp(int, char const*, char const* const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.getWaitExitCode(int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.getWaitExitSig(int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.getWaitExitCore(int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.getWaitStopSig(int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.ptraceKill(int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.ptraceContinue(int,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: WAIT_WNOHANG
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.INHERENT_fork()
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.sv1tlog(char const*, ...)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.addBeforeExit(char const*, void (*)(void*, ...), void*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.shiobar(char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.client_open(char const*, char const*, char const*,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.RecvLine(int, void*,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.DELEGATE_ver()
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.getpeerNAME(int, char const*, int, char const*, int, char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.GetHostname(char const*, int, char const*, int, char const*,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.connectToMyself(char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.callDelegate1(int, char const*, char const*,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.timegm(tm*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.simple_relayf(FILE*, FILE*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.Gunzip(char const*, FILE*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.INHERENT_lstat()
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.Scandir(char const*, int (*)(char const*, ...), ...)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.system_CGI(char const*, char const*, char const*, char const*, int, char const*, int, char const*, char const*, FILE*, FILE*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.genheadf(char const*, char const*, int, char const*, int, char const*,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.HTTP_putMIMEmsg(DGCtx*, FILE*, FILE*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.builtin_filter(char const*, char const*, FILE*, FILE*, FILE*, FILE*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.systemFilter(char const*, FILE*, FILE*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: scan_ino
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.lock_exclusiveTO(int, int,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.reverseMOUNT(DGCtx*, char const*, int, char const*, int, char const*,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: WithThread
##ERROR## ld: 0711-317 ERROR: Undefined symbol: ThreadFork
##ERROR## ld: 0711-317 ERROR: Undefined symbol: ThreadYield
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.alloca_call(AllocaArg*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.str_isStr(FILE*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.decomp_absurl(char const*, char const*, int, char const*, int, char const*, char const*, int, char const*, int, char const*, char const*, int, char const*, int, char const*, int)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.serviceport(char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.getURLgetURL()
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.scan_protositeport(char const*, char const*, int, char const*, int, char const*, char const*, int, char const*, int, char const*, char const*, int, char const*, int, char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.html_nextTagAttrX(void*, char const*, char const*, char const*, int, char const*, int, char const*, char const**, char const**, int*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.isFullURL(char const*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.URLget(char const*, int, FILE*)
##ERROR## ld: 0711-317 ERROR: Undefined symbol: .DELEGATE_verdate()
##ERROR## ld: 0711-345 Use the -bloadmap or -bnoquiet option to obtain more information.
##ERROR## collect2: ld returned 8 exit status
##ERROR##

FATAL!!!!: Something wrong in Libraries.
make: 1254-004 The error code from the last command is 3.


Stop.
make: 1254-004 The error code from the last command is 2.


Stop.
mkmake: ERROR LOG is left at /TST/EXSE/messaging.v2003/secureEDI/delegate8.11.2/maker/mkmake.err
mkmake: ERROR LOG is left at /TST/EXSE/messaging.v2003/secureEDI/delegate8.11.2/maker/mkmake.err
make: 1254-004 The error code from the last command is 2.


Stop.
make: 1254-004 The error code from the last command is 2.


Stop.
mkmake: ERROR LOG is left at /TST/EXSE/messaging.v2003/secureEDI/delegate8.11.2/src/mkmake.err
mkmake: ERROR LOG is left at /TST/EXSE/messaging.v2003/secureEDI/delegate8.11.2/src/mkmake.err
make: 1254-004 The error code from the last command is 2.


Stop.

mailhub@rgom303:/opt/mailhub/secureEDI/delegate8.11.2/teleport
> ls -alrt
total 456
-rw-r--r--   1 mailhub  mail           4869 Apr 21 1996  README
-rw-r--r--   1 mailhub  mail            535 Nov 02 11:19 teleport.h
-rw-r--r--   1 mailhub  mail           2380 Jan 14 16:07 qz.c
-rw-r--r--   1 mailhub  mail           5244 Mar 01 00:44 qzcode.c
-rw-r--r--   1 mailhub  mail          26528 Mar 01 00:44 vehicle.c
-rw-r--r--   1 mailhub  mail          20512 Mar 01 00:45 teleportd.c
-rw-r--r--   1 mailhub  mail           1342 Mar 14 13:10 Makefile
drwxr-xr-x  16 mailhub  mail           1024 Apr 06 14:22 ../
-rw-r--r--   1 mailhub  mail          20648 Apr 06 14:23 teleportd.cc
-rw-r--r--   1 mailhub  mail           1747 Apr 06 14:23 Makefile.go
-rw-r--r--   1 mailhub  mail          26706 Apr 06 14:23 vehicle.cc
-rw-r--r--   1 mailhub  mail          27401 Apr 06 14:23 teleportd.o
-rw-r--r--   1 mailhub  mail          37676 Apr 06 14:23 vehicle.o
-rw-r--r--   1 mailhub  mail           8121 Apr 06 14:23 qzcode.o
-rw-r--r--   1 mailhub  mail           5276 Apr 06 14:23 qzcode.cc
drwxr-xr-x   2 mailhub  mail            512 Apr 06 14:23 ./
mailhub@rgom303:/opt/mailhub/secureEDI/delegate8.11.2/teleport
> ls -lart ../lib
total 2608
-rw-r--r--   1 mailhub  mail            271 Jul 17 1998  README
drwxr-xr-x  16 mailhub  mail           1024 Apr 06 14:22 ../
-rw-r--r--   1 mailhub  mail          74858 Apr 06 14:23 libteleport.a
-rw-r--r--   1 mailhub  mail         145145 Apr 06 14:23 libresolvy.a
-rw-r--r--   1 mailhub  mail         195024 Apr 06 14:23 libmimekit.a
-rw-r--r--   1 mailhub  mail          16023 Apr 06 14:23 libmd5.a
-rw-r--r--   1 mailhub  mail          80232 Apr 06 14:23 libcfi.a
-rw-r--r--   1 mailhub  mail         693281 Apr 06 14:23 library.a
-rw-r--r--   1 mailhub  mail         105679 Apr 06 14:23 libfsx.a
drwxr-xr-x   2 mailhub  mail            512 Apr 06 14:23 ./



-----Original Message-----
From: Yutaka Sato [mailto:feedback@delegate.org]
Sent: mercredi 6 avril 2005 0:09
To: feedback@delegate.org
Cc: feedback@delegate.org; Rousseau Pierre (DBB)
Subject: Re: [DeleGate-En:2897] Compilation of delegate 8.11.2


In message <1B97679BE0734146931E06AC03E94B9F030BB0BD@BHBRVEXM002.dbb.int.dexwired.net> on 04/05/05(21:48:46)
you "Rousseau Pierre \(DBB\)" <pjyfqbdyi-gztnjky4fbnr.ml@ml.delegate.org> wrote:
 |I have downloaded new version of delegate. I have extracted files on AIX5.2 server and I have launched compilation with CC... (see in attached file"Compilation")
...
 |make: 1254-053 Command "$(MKCPP)" expands to empty string.
 |
 |cc: 1501-228 input file c++ not found

It is likely that your CC does not recognize "-x c++" option which means
getting input file as a C++ program.

 |If I try to execute only "cc -O -x c++ -DQS -I../include -O -c teleportd.c -o teleportd.o" in teleport folder, the error is the same.
 |For information, I have successfuly compiled Delegate8.9.6 on the same machine...

DeleGate has come to be based on C++ and C99 instead of K&R C after the
version 8.10.

 |Do you have idea about this issue?

If your CC supports C++, then the following might make it advance:


  % make clean
  % make CFLAGSPLUS="-DNONC99 -DQS -TP"

Otherwise, you might be able to make DeleGate without boundary checking
feature, thus dangerous to use, like this, but I never recommend this:

  % make CFLAGSPLUS="-DNONC99"

Cheers,
Yutaka
--
  D G   Yutaka Sato <y.sato@delegate.org> http://delegate.org/y.sato/
 ( - )  National Institute of Advanced Industrial Science and Technology
_<   >_ 1-1-4 Umezono, Tsukuba, Ibaraki, 305-8568 Japan
Do the more with the less -- B. Fuller

--------------------------------------
Dexia Bank disclaimer :
http://www.dexia.be/maildisclaimer.htm
--------------------------------------

  


  admin search upper oldest olders older1 this newer1 newers latest
[Top/Up] [oldest] - [Older+chunk] - [Newer+chunk] - [newest + Check]
@_@V